⚽︎ How to Build a Winning Brand as a Private Soccer Coach (2025 Guide)

In today’s competitive private soccer training industry, being a great coach isn’t enough anymore—you also need a great brand. Whether you’re working with youth players, college athletes, or professionals, your personal brand determines how clients perceive your value, professionalism, and expertise.
Let’s explore how you can build a powerful, authentic brand that wins both on and off the field.

Define Your Coaching Identity

Your brand starts with clarity. Ask yourself:

  • What type of players do I want to train?

  • What makes my coaching style unique?

  • What are my coaching values and results?

This helps you position yourself—whether you’re “the elite performance trainer” or “the technical skill specialist.”

Craft a Clear Value Proposition

Your value proposition is what sets you apart. It should answer:

“Why should a player choose you instead of another coach?”
Keep it short and strong, e.g.,
“I help youth soccer players master game intelligence and technical precision through customized 1-on-1 training.”

Build a Professional Online Presence

Your online presence is your digital home. Make sure you have:

  • A professional website with booking and testimonials

  • A strong Instagram and TikTok presence with drills, client results, and player tips

  • A LinkedIn profile to network with parents, schools, and clubs

💡 Pro Tip: Use consistent colors, fonts, and logos across all platforms to increase brand recognition.

Showcase Social Proof

Post before-and-after training clips, testimonials, and success stories.
People trust proof. Highlight measurable improvements like:

“Player X improved sprint time by 0.5 seconds after 6 weeks.”

Create Valuable Content

Content builds trust before clients even meet you.
Examples include:

  • Short-form video tutorials

  • Blog posts on “How to Improve First Touch”

  • Free downloadable guides (e.g., “5 Warm-Up Routines for Strikers”)

This establishes you as an authority in your niche.

Optimize for Local SEO

If you train players in person, local SEO is key.
Use terms like:

“Private soccer coach in [Your City]”
and create a Google Business Profile so clients can find and review you easily.

Network with Clubs and Schools

Partnerships with local academies, schools, and athletic programs can build long-term credibility and referral pipelines.

Build a Brand Experience

From your logo to your communication style—make every interaction consistent.
Your tone, visual design, and professionalism should all reflect your coaching philosophy.

Collect and Display Testimonials

After a player reaches a goal, ask for feedback.
Turn that into a testimonial with permission to share on social media or your website.

Keep Evolving

Great brands never stop improving. Track your progress, stay updated on soccer trends, and refresh your brand visuals or offers yearly.

⚽︎ How to Build and Grow a Private Soccer Coaching Business

If you’re a private soccer coach, you already know how rewarding it is to help players reach their potential. But being great on the field isn’t enough — to build a sustainable, profitable soccer coaching business, you need to master the business side too.

Whether you’re just starting out or looking to scale, this article will walk you through proven strategies to grow your private soccer coaching business and attract more loyal clients.

Define Your Niche and Ideal Player

Not every soccer player is the same — and not every private coach should try to train everyone. Start by identifying your soccer coaching niche:

  • Youth players (ages 8–13)

  • High school or academy players

  • College-bound athletes

  • Elite-level or semi-pro players

  • Position-specific coaching (strikers, goalkeepers, defenders)

👉 The clearer your niche, the easier it is to attract the right players into your program and charge premium rates. Parents and players prefer specialists over generalists.

Build a Professional Soccer Coaching Brand

Your brand is more than your logo — it’s the experience and trust you create.

Here’s how to build a strong soccer coaching brand presence:

  • Create a name and logo that reflect your coaching philosophy.

  • Get professional photos of you coaching, your sessions, and testimonials.

  • Launch a simple website with key pages:

    • About / Credentials

    • Coaching Packages

    • Testimonials & Success Stories

    • Booking or Contact Page

💡 Pro Tip: Add a “Player Results” section showing improvements (speed, skills, goals) — measurable results convert visitors into clients.

Use Social Media Strategically

Social media is a goldmine for private soccer coaches — especially Instagram, TikTok, and YouTube Shorts.

What to post:

  • Training clips and drills

  • Before-and-after player progress

  • Testimonials from parents

  • Quick tips and motivational content

Be consistent. Post at least 3–4 times per week and use location-based hashtags like #soccercoachlondon or #privatesoccertrainingNYC to attract local players.

Collect and Showcase Social Proof

Parents and players trust results, not promises. Build social proof by:

  • Asking satisfied clients for video testimonials

  • Sharing before-and-after stats (speed, accuracy, fitness levels)

  • Getting Google My Business and Yelp reviews

Even 3–5 strong testimonials can dramatically increase bookings.

Offer Flexible Soccer Coaching Packages

Design packages that fit different goals and budgets:

  • Intro Session: Free or discounted trial

  • 5-Session Pack: Great for short-term improvement

  • Monthly Membership: Best for consistent progress

  • Team or Group Sessions: Increase income while training more players at once

Make it easy to book online and clearly communicate pricing — transparency builds trust.

Partner with Local Youth Soccer Clubs and Schools

Build relationships with:

  • Youth soccer clubs

  • PE teachers and athletic directors

  • Sports shops or gyms

Offer free demo sessions or group workshops — these connections can generate steady client referrals.

Leverage Word-of-Mouth and Referrals

Your best clients are your best marketers. Create a referral program that rewards them:

  • “Refer a player and get 1 free session.”

  • “Bring a teammate and both get 20% off your next package.”

These small incentives can lead to exponential growth.

Keep Learning and Show Your Expertise

Stay ahead of the curve by continuously learning:

  • Earn USSF or UEFA coaching licenses

  • Attend workshops or sports science seminars

  • Read coaching and mindset books

Then, share what you learn online — it positions you as a trusted expert in player development.

Track Your Progress and Adapt

Every top coach uses data — not just for players, but for business.
Track:

  • Number of new clients per month

  • Retention rates

  • Website or social media engagement

  • Revenue growth

If something’s working, double down. If not, test new approaches. The key is consistent improvement.

Deliver an Amazing Client Experience

Finally — nothing beats great coaching.
Deliver sessions that are:

  • Fun, structured, and challenging

  • Personalized to each player’s goals

  • Backed by clear feedback and progress tracking

When players see real results, they stay longer and tell others.
